The Indian Agriculture Minister, Narendra Singh Tomar, has launched ‘DigiClaim’, a new platform on the national crop insurance portal designed to speed up the payment of insurance claims to farmers who have taken out crop insurance policies. To demonstrate the platform’s efficiency, the Minister transferred a sum of Rs. 1,260.35 crore in insurance claims to insured farmers across multiple states in India, including Rajasthan, Uttar Pradesh, Himachal Pradesh, Chhattisgarh, Uttarakhand, and Haryana, with a single click.
The newly launched DigiClaim platform will enable farmers to receive their insurance claims directly in their bank accounts, in a transparent and accountable manner. The technology behind this platform has been developed through the integration of the National Crop Insurance Portal (NCIP) and the Public Finance Management System (PFMS). As a result, the platform is expected to reduce the claim reversal ratio. Moreover, farmers will be able to track the progress of their claims in real-time using their mobile phones and access the benefits of the scheme more easily.
